[[!comment format=mdwn username="http://cstork.org/" nickname="Chris Stork" subject="git annex get/sync don't delete files" date="2013-10-10T11:43:29Z" content=""" AFAIU it's impossible for the 'get' subcommand to delete anything because it only copies files to .git/annex/objects. 'sync' should also never delete files because it only adds files to the annex (i.e. checksums them and sets up the links and directories in .git/annex), commits things to git and pulls/pushes the git-annex specific branches to/from other repos. So I think some other 'nono' must have messed up your files. If you ever used (maybe unintentionally) used indirect mode there seem to be a rather high chance that some of your otherwise lost content is still in .git/annex/objects.
